Que outros diálogos são exibidos ao executar aplicações com o certificado assinado confiável?


Este artigo aplica-se a:
  • Java version(s): 7.0, 8.0

Começando com Java Version 7 Update 45, foram adicionadas as melhorias de segurança para execução das aplicações Java. Esta página descreve variações da caixa de diálogo para aplicações Java com um certificado de uma autoridade confiável.

Diálogo de Segurança para atributo de permissão ausente no arquivo JAR

O aviso no diálogo é apresentado porque o editor não definiu o atributo de permissões no arquivo JAR.

O que procurar:
  • Título da caixa de diálogo: Aplicação Bloqueada ou Aplicação Java Bloqueada (Java 8)
  • Título da mensagem: Aplicação Bloqueada pelas Definições de Segurança ou Aplicação Bloqueada pela Segurança Java (Java 8)
  • Mensagem: suas definições de segurança impediram a execução de uma aplicação em decorrência de falta de um atributo do manifesto de permissões no jar principal
    Por motivos de segurança, as aplicações devem atender aos requisitos das definições de segurança Alta ou Muito Alta ou devem fazer parte da Lista de Sites de Exceção, para terem permissão de execução. (8u20 e versões posteriores)
Java 8u20 e versões posteriores
Aplicação confiável com certificado válido, mas sem permissão de JRE 8
Java 7u71 e versões 7 posteriores
Aplicação confiável com certificado válido, mas sem permissão de JRE 8
O que fazer:
  • Como usuário final, você pode optar por notificar o editor de que você está vendo esta notificação enquanto executa a aplicação.
  • É altamente recomendável não executar este tipo de aplicação. No entanto, se estiver ciente do risco e, ainda assim, quiser executar a aplicação, você poderá adicionar o URL desta aplicação à Lista de Sites de Exceção que está localizada na guia Segurança do Painel de Controle Java. A inclusão bem-sucedida do URL desta aplicação nessa lista permitirá que a aplicação seja executada após a exibição de algumas advertências de segurança.
    » Como gerenciar e configurar uma Lista de Sites de Exceção?


Caixa de Diálogo de Segurança com nome da aplicação ausente

A caixa de diálogo é apresentada porque o editor não forneceu o nome da aplicação em um mecanismo seguro.

O que procurar:
  • A aplicação não está exibindo o nome da Aplicação.
Aplicação confiável com certificado válido, mas nome de aplicação ausente

O que fazer:
  • Só execute essa aplicação se você confiar no editor e nas informações de localização do site exibidas nesta caixa de diálogo.

Caixa de Diálogo de Segurança exibindo vários locais

A caixa de diálogo é apresentada porque o editor hospedou a aplicação em vários locais.

O que procurar:
  • A aplicação que exibe vários locais.
Aplicação confiável com certificado válido, mas exibindo vários locais
O que fazer:
  • Só execute essa aplicação se confiar no editor e em cada um dos locais.